Our Services

At Empilweni Psychological Services, we offer a range of services to meet your mental health needs. Our team of skilled practitioners is trained in the latest techniques and approaches to ensure that you receive the best possible care. Some of our services include:

01

Individual psychotherapy

Individual psychotherapy is personalized therapy where a trained therapist helps a client tackle emotional or psychological challenges through one-on-one sessions. The focus is on the individual's thoughts, feelings, and behaviors, aiming for personal growth and improved mental well-being.

02

Group psychotherapy

Group psychotherapy involves a therapist leading a group of individuals who come together to discuss and work on common psychological issues or goals. Members share experiences, provide support, and learn from one another under the guidance of the therapist. It provides a supportive environment for interpersonal growth, insight, and behavioral change through interaction with others facing similar challenges.

03

Child Psychotherapy

Child psychotherapy involves a trained therapist working with children to address emotional, behavioral, or developmental challenges. Through play, conversation, and age-appropriate techniques, the therapist helps the child express feelings, develop coping skills, and navigate difficulties. The focus is on the child's unique needs and experiences, aiming to promote emotional well-being and healthy development.

04

All psychometric assessments 

These are:

  1. Child Assessments: Child assessments are standardized tests used by professionals to evaluate a child's development, behavior, cognition, and emotions. They include developmental, behavioral, cognitive, academic, social-emotional, speech-language, adaptive behavior, and sensory processing assessments. These assessments help identify strengths, challenges, and areas needing intervention to support the child's overall well-being and academic success. 

  2. Adult Assessments: Adult assessment utilizes standardized tests to evaluate an adult's mental health, personality, cognition, and emotional well-being. Conducted by professionals, these tests inform treatment plans and interventions tailored to individual needs.
